A word of warning on this amp. With that switch changing the bias on the output stage, B+ is going to be moving around. Because of the way that the Tremolo "Depth" control is tied into the Phase Inverter, if B+ is too high, no signal will get through the Phase Inverter to the Power Tubes. Solution, lower that tail resistor in the Phase inverter.

You are going to have to experiment to get it working with all combinations of output bias. A higher resistance Depth control might be needed. The Depth control pulls the cathodes positive and that starts to bias the PI colder reducing the gain. This is a unique circuit among Fender amps.

Swapping around to different b+ voltages calls for more then just adding screen resistors which should be done anyway.
You need.
A higher wattage rating Ot.

You need switchable cathode resistors.

The use of a EL34 requires pin 1 to be tied to pin 8, and many times since pin 1 is not used in a 6v6 or 6L6 type tube that pin is used as a 1 pin terminal strip/ tie point.

Well, after a long time waiting, I finally got this together over the weekend. While everything *works*, it needs a few tweaks. Here goes:

-Bias resistors will need modification. The 250/333/500 setup isn't quite going to cut it. With a 5Y3 and 6K6GT tubes, they're running at 108% dissipation with a 500 ohm cathode resistor. With a 5U4GB and 6L6GC, the highest I could get to was 71.3%. So, I think I'm going to go with a setup to get me 176/375/600. I temporarily jumpered all of the resistors together to get 195 ohms, and that was good enough to get the EL34s I had in at the time to 90%, so 176 should be good for EL34/6L6. Hopefully, 600 will be high enough to tame the 6K6s. Guess we'll see!

-Tremolo section needs work. The speed switch works, but at its highest speed, it kills the oscillation. Might try tacking in another cap to see if that helps. Also, there's no action on the intensity until the pot's turned up over half, then it all hits at once. It may be that I have an audio taper pot in there instead of linear. Will check it out.

-On startup, voltages approach 500VDC in my power string, settling down after the tubes warm up. My caps are rated to 450V. Is this an issue?

I think that's pretty much it. Reasonably quiet, except when cascading the channels. There are three very distinct different sounds with this, which is nice. It's got the standard tweed-sounding input, a Marshall-like input, and then the higher-gain option with the flip of the switch. I'll try for a little further assessment after I get the bias sorted out. All things considered, I'm happy with the result so far. I'll try to snap some pics after it's finalized. Will also update the layout/schematic to the "as-built" version when I'm satisfied with the "as-built" amp.

Edit: I measured the intensity pot last night and, as suspected, it's an audio taper. I'll swap in a linear one soon. Speaking of pots, I'm also betting my speed pot is only 500k vs. 1M that the schematic specifies. I think that may well be why my speed gets so fast that it kills the oscillation.

Parts arrived this weekend, so I made my (hopefully) final changes. Brief rundown:

-Bias resistors were modified. Long story short, I was able to get the EL34s to 93.2% dissipation, and the 6K6GTs down to 101.2%. I think that's close enough for me. Anecdotally, people run 6K6 in a 5E3 Deluxe with no modifications just fine, which is way harder on them than what I'm doing.

-Tremolo section - Still had some issues even after subbing in proper pots. I upped C15 to .02, which helped to an extent, but I still was losing oscillation on the high and low end. I replaced the tube with a stronger 6SL7, and got the low part to tighten up. I ended up goosing the tube a little by upping the plate resistor from 220K to 330K. Problem solved!

Here are my last questions, if anyone has any thoughts:

-My startup voltages still exceed my filter cap rating 450VDC. Is this an issue?

-My EL34 tubes are weird...when you look inside the holes of the plate structure, it appears that the grid wires glow blue. This isn't the normal blue glow like one might see in the glass. Fun fact, if the tremolo is on, the glow oscillates on and off with the beat of the trem, if that helps.

-My tremolo is satisfactory, however, there's not a huge difference between the speeds. I put my frequency counter on it, and on slow my range is 3.1-6.21Hz. Fast is 3.96-9.26Hz. Would it be worth it to increase R25 to slow down the slow range a bit more? Practically, how low can this frequency really go?
